Found it.

I researched it a little. Depending on boost level you may need an intercooler which can add a cost. Prices I've come up with...

Vortech kit: $2000
Blow through demon: $400-$600

Now some optional additional costs that can add to the price.

Intercooler: $200-$400
Tubing: nickle and dime you to death
Optional blower cam change: $200-$500 depending on roller or non
Lower compression ratio: Really depends



Now depending on your headgasket thickness, chamber size, piston design you might be able to squeek out that 1 point of compression by pulling the heads, having someone that knows what theyre doing port the chambers for a few more CCs and using a thicker head gasket. The other option is to find someone who would trade you a bigger chambered head for yours.

The 125hp rating is based on adding that to a stock motor. I researched he super charger trim/size and the V3 si supports 725 or 775hp and like 25psi.

Thats at least a year out for me lol. I plan on putting the 355 in my car, driving it while I build myself a truck. Once my truck is built the 442 will go back in the shop for a built trans first and then a wicked motor.

I'm on the fence on alot of things. Centrifugal or Roots blower, stick with a stock block and do a 383 or 388 OR go big bucks with an aftermarket block and 434ci.

Either way I'll be aiming for a 450-500hp 8.5:1 motor base with 10-12 pounds on top. I'm hoping to put out between 650-750hp at the crank for a goal of 500hp to the wheels and run a 10.0-10.4 on drag radial and still be completely streetable and driven daily (when its nice out lol).

I will be building it from the very start with the super charger. So I'll be choosing heads, cam, compression, etc all on the plans to have it blown.
